iGarden and the French Swimming Federation Launch Exclusive Strategic Partnership to Innovate Swimming in France

iGarden and the French Swimming Federation: A New Era of Collaboration



On February 13, 2026, iGarden, an innovative brand under the Fairland Group, officially announced a strategic partnership with the Fédération Française de Natation (FFN). This collaboration marks a significant milestone not just for both entities but also for the future of intelligent water technology in France. The unveiling was showcased at an exclusive event attended by FFN athletes, media representatives, distributors, and influencers, with French Olympic legends Alain Bernard and Fabien Gilot present as special guests.

A Partnership Built on Shared Values



Unlike traditional sports sponsorships, this partnership between iGarden and FFN was not established merely for branding purposes. The federation chose to collaborate with iGarden because of its professional standards, the reliability of its systems, and its long-term value proposition. FFN, recognized as the only swimming authority endorsed by World Aquatics and the French Olympic Committee, mandates high requirements for its partners concerning stability, safety, and sustainable performance.

iGarden's expertise in smart gardening and pool technologies aligns closely with FFN’s professional values, leading to the designation of iGarden as the official Smart Pool Technology partner. This designation sets a new benchmark in the industry, emphasizing a collective belief that true performance is rooted in technology that stands the test of time.

During the event, iGarden unveiled its strategic roadmap for the French market through 2026, detailing a phased market entry plan and showcasing its latest smart water product line. The company emphasized its system-oriented approach and eco-friendly design principles, showcasing how its innovations could redefine outdoor living in France.

The portfolio includes the world's first AI vision pool cleaning robot, the pioneering AI swim jet for elite training, and durable robotic lawn mowers for property maintenance. Each solution is designed for longevity, delivering professional-grade performance as validated by FFN.

Tackling Modern Smart Home Challenges



iGarden is addressing a critical challenge in modern smart homes—the fragmentation of devices. Until now, many devices operated in isolation, necessitating individual attention and leading to separate maintenance costs. To combat this, iGarden is introducing the AI Garden Ecosystem, the industry's first genuine AIoT system for garden robots.

This ecosystem integrates all devices into a cohesive, intelligent network, enabling centralized control while drastically reducing maintenance time and optimizing operations. The enhancements are geared towards making outdoor tasks more efficient and autonomous.

Showcasing Technology in Action



The event featured dynamic demonstrations from the French national swimming team, with Olympic champions Alain Bernard and Fabien Gilot showcasing iGarden technology in action. Guests watched as participants took on the Swim Jet Challenge and observed the effortless execution of the “Stone Debris Cleaning Demo” by iGarden’s pool cleaning robots, highlighting the precision, power, and reliability of iGarden products.

According to Charlene Feng, Brand Manager at iGarden, “The partnership with the Fédération Française de Natation validates our commitment to developing technology that athletes can depend on and underscores our shared goal to push boundaries. For us, this means creating experiences that bring families and athletes closer to the water at all times.” She added, “The introduction of the iGarden Smart Water Ecosystem in France reflects our dedication to making water sports accessible, reliable, and sustainable, supported by performance that exceeds the expectations of tomorrow's pool owners.”

FFN’s president, Gilles Sezionale, emphasized that this partnership perfectly aligns with their ambition to innovate within competitive swimming. By collaborating with a recognized technology company, they reinforce their ability to support swimmers, clubs, and regions in advancing towards a more efficient, modern, and sustainable form of the sport.
